Exemple #1
0
        //Constructeur
        public Reservation(Adherent unAdherent, Court unCourt, DateTime uneDtReservation, int unNbJoueurs)
        {
            this.numeroReservation = GestionClub.getDernierNumReserv();
            GestionClub.setDernierNumReserv(GestionClub.getDernierNumReserv() + 1);

            this.adherentReserve = unAdherent;
            this.courtReserve    = unCourt;
            this.dtReservation   = uneDtReservation;
            this.nbJoueurs       = unNbJoueurs;
            this.adherentReserve.setNbReservation(this.adherentReserve.getNbReservation() - 1);

            GestionClub.getToutesLesReservations().Add(this);
        }
 private void bt_gestionCourt_add_valid_Click(object sender, EventArgs e)
 {
     try
     {
         Court c1 = new Court(Convert.ToInt32(bt_gestionCourt_add_nbPlaces.Text));
         //Message qui affiche que l'ajout a bien été effectué en décrémentant le numéro de court car après la création d'un Court il est augmenté
         MessageBox.Show("Le court n°" + (GestionClub.getDernierNumCourt() - 1) + " a bien été ajouté");
     }
     catch
     {
         bt_gestionCourt_add_nbPlaces.Clear();
         MessageBox.Show("Saisie invalide, veuillez saisir un numérique");
     }
 }
Exemple #3
0
 public Court setCourtReserve(Court unCourt)
 {
     return(this.courtReserve = unCourt);
 }